Talent & Development Section Head (Ref. AD/25/16)

hace 3 semanas


Barcelona, España Somma A tiempo completo

IRB Barcelona seeks to recruit a Section Head of Talent & Development to lead and shape the institute’s talent strategy within the People & Academic Affairs team. In this strategic role, you will coordinate a dynamic team and oversee recruitment, onboarding, talent development, and institutional HR initiatives. You’ll work closely with scientific leadership, core facilities, and partners to attract, develop, and retain world‑class professionals. Your leadership will help shape how we grow and support the people behind our science. Key responsibilities Lead and continuously improve recruitment and onboarding processes across scientific, technical, and administrative roles. Partner with hiring managers to identify talent needs, develop job profiles, and deliver inclusive, high‑quality selection processes. Oversee relocation and visa processes for international hires. Co‑design and implement talent development initiatives (e.g., onboarding, training, career development). Monitor and report on HR metrics and KPIs related to recruitment, onboarding, and learning. Ensure alignment with institutional policies (OTM‑R, HRS4R), labour law, and equality & diversity standards. Manage strategic HR projects including system implementations, external audits, or institutional accreditations. Provide guidance and mentorship to junior HR staff and act as a point of contact for internal stakeholders. You have Experience 5+ years in HR or talent development roles, with experience managing or coordinating small teams. Strong track record in recruitment and/or learning & development, ideally in research, higher education, or the public sector. Knowledge Degree in Psychology, Labour Relations, Humanities or a related field, ideally with a specialisation in HR. Solid knowledge of Spanish labour law, HR policies, and EU standards related to research careers (e.g., HRS4R, OTM‑R). Experience in international hiring and mobility. Skills Strong leadership and people management skills. Excellent interpersonal and communication abilities. High level of autonomy, decision‑making, and strategic thinking. Project management skills and ability to handle multiple priorities. Proficiency in Catalan, Spanish, and English. Advanced user of Excel and HR software (SAP, TeamTailor, etc.). You might also have A Master's degree in Human Resources Management. Experience coordinating HR projects in a research institute or academic environment. Knowledge of immigration.
